LDP party will vote to select its leader on Sat. It is a full-spec vote, meaning that the election is conducted in its complete format. Each of the LDP's 295 Diet members will cast a vote, and another 295 votes will be determined based on ballots of rank-and-file members (about 1.1mio of them).

The US government shutdown adds another layer of data and market uncertainty. Past shutdowns have often coincided with demand for safe haven proxy including gold while the USD broadly traded softer though outcomes can vary with duration of shutdown.

BOJ Governor Ueda said rate hikes will continue if forecasts hold, but warned tariffs and global risks cloud the outlook. He highlighted moderating growth, slower U.S. job gains, and fragile wage momentum, while stressing the need to maintain accommodative support for Japan’s economy.
A U.S.-U.A.E. deal to deliver Nvidia AI chips has stalled, with Emirati investments in the U.S. still pending. Commerce Secretary Howard Lutnick has tied export approval to those commitments, while security concerns over the U.A.E.’s China ties add to the delay.
